# Basement Archive Room — Night Access

The archive room under Pellworth House holds old contracts and the tape backups. Night shift: take stairwell C, not the lift (it's switched off after midnight). Lights are on a timer by the door — slap the button as you go in. Sign the logbook, even at 3am, yes really. The keypad by the door takes the code below.

staff pass of fahap-tajeg = bdg-FT-6

// Client setup for Splitfern, our A/B assignment service.
// Assignments are deterministic per user hash; do not cache
// them across experiment versions or rollouts will skew.
// Release manager note: bump the experiment manifest version
// before each deploy, otherwise Splitfern serves stale arms.
// The client authenticates with the staging key on the next line.

API key for yahig-tadup: kto7_ubizbYm

## Formula sandbox tuning

User-supplied formulas in Gridmoor execute inside a restricted interpreter with hard ceilings on time, memory, and call depth. Reviewers should confirm any change to these ceilings is justified in the PR description, since raising them widens the abuse surface. Defaults were chosen from production traces. The current limits are as follows.

limits module of tafog-fawip:
WEIGHTS = {
    "julix": 57,
    "lamys": 992,
    "kasvan": 209,
    "quenok": 750,
    "alddor": 259,
    "oliath": 1009,
    "wenix": 815,
}